9. Tsuyu Asui - Frog

Suffering a similar fate to Mina, Tsuyu’s frog quirk kinda just gives you the ick.

Embodying all the jumping, swimming and wall-climbing capabilities of a frog also comes with a handful of grim amphibian attributes. Secreting itch-inducing mucus from her armpits, ejecting her stomach contents and of course an abnormally long tongue. The end result is a hero that you look at and think: “she probably stinks”.

Yuckiness aside, another fatal flaw for Tsuyu is her cold-bloodedness. This means that in hot temperatures she is prone to drying out and becoming fatigued, obstructing her ability to use her quirk. And worse still, when exposed to low temperatures, she enters a hibernation state, instantly passing out into a deep sleep.

A superhero whose biggest weakness is air conditioning? Thanks, but I’ll pass.
